  • Performance
    CodeIgniter is known for its exceptional performance and fast execution, which is beneficial for applications requiring quick load times.
  • Documentation
    CodeIgniter offers comprehensive and clear documentation, making it easier for developers to understand and use the framework effectively.
  • Easy to Learn
    CodeIgniter's simple and straightforward syntax makes it relatively easy for beginners to learn and start developing applications quickly.
  • Lightweight
    The framework is lightweight and does not impose many dependencies or require a specific server environment, providing flexibility to developers.
  • Community Support
    CodeIgniter has a strong and active community, which means plenty of resources, forums, and add-ons are available for developers.
  • Built-in Security Features
    CodeIgniter comes with built-in security features like XSS filtering and CSRF protection, helping developers to secure their applications with minimal effort.
  • MVC Architecture
    The framework follows the Model-View-Controller (MVC) architecture, promoting clean code separation and better organization of the project.

Possible disadvantages

  • Lack of Modern Features
    CodeIgniter does not include many modern features found in other frameworks, such as built-in ORM or out-of-the-box RESTful API support.
  • Limited Modular Extensions
    It has fewer modular extensions compared to other frameworks like Laravel or Symfony, which can limit code reusability and scalability.
  • Manual Routing
    Routing in CodeIgniter is somewhat manual and less intuitive compared to other frameworks that offer more automatic and flexible routing mechanisms.
  • Outdated PHP Practices
    Some of the practices and conventions in CodeIgniter are considered outdated with respect to modern PHP development trends.
  • No Built-in Authentication
    CodeIgniter does not come with a built-in authentication system, requiring developers to implement their own or use third-party libraries.
  • Less Emphasis on Testing
    CodeIgniter has less built-in support and emphasis on unit testing compared to other frameworks like Laravel, making it harder to implement TDD or BDD.
  • Lack of Native Composer Support
    The framework's native support for Composer, PHP's dependency manager, is not as robust as other modern frameworks, which can complicate dependency management.

Overall verdict

  • Yes, CodeIgniter is a good choice for developers looking for a simple and efficient PHP framework. It's particularly well-suited for projects where performance is a priority, and extensive feature sets found in larger frameworks are not necessary.

Why this product is good

  • CodeIgniter is considered a good PHP framework because it is lightweight, easy to set up, and requires minimal server resources. It offers a straightforward approach to building web applications, especially for developers who appreciate simplicity and performance. Its comprehensive documentation and active community support are additional positives.

Recommended for

  • Developers who need a lightweight and fast framework
  • Projects with straightforward requirements and simplistic architectures
  • Developers who prefer a framework with easy installation and minimal configuration
  • Smaller projects or prototypes that require rapid development
  • Projects with limited server resources
